Sorry I'm coming a little late to this and I'm confused. I have some questions?
1) Does CLANG9 imply CLANGPE? 
2) Does CLANGPE work on Linux and macOS? Can you pass the Windows style arguments to CLANGPE linker on Linux and macOS?
3) For the EmulatorPkg don't you have the extra requirement that compiler needs a standard C lib (or platform specific libs) to function?
a) GCC:*_CLANG9_*_DLINK_FLAGS in EmulatorPkg.dsc seems to imply the Linux and macOS systems will have a Windows SKD dir and a lot of Windows DLLs? Does all that come when you install CLANG9 when you install it on Linux or macOS?

So I guess I'm asking is the linker really the same for CLANG9 on all systems? I guess the answer could be yes, but it seems the C lib for the Host App is still an App for that OS and is OS dependent? 

Sorry if I'm missing something fundamental and this is a dumb question.

Subject: [Patch v3 10/11] EmulatorPkg: Enable CLANG9 tool chain

BZ: https://bugzilla.tianocore.org/show_bug.cgi?id=1603
1. Add WIN_SEC_BUILD macro check for CLANG9 tool chain build -p
EmulatorPkg\EmulatorPkg.dsc -a IA32 -DWIN_SEC_BUILD=TRUE -t CLANG9
build -p EmulatorPkg\EmulatorPkg.dsc -a X64 -DWIN_SEC_BUILD=TRUE -t
CLANG9 2. Append CLANG CC and LINK flags to generate windows HOST.
3. Fix WinHost issue to call GetProcessAffinityMask() API.
  The input parameter should be UINTN pointer instead of UINT32 pointer.
